Join Little Critter as he learns why it’s important to be thankful for what he has---not to be upset about what he doesn't. Since 1975, Mercer Mayer has been writing and illustrating stories about Little Critter and the antics he stumbles into while growing up.
Being Thankful by Mercer Mayer is a heartwarming tale that teaches children about the power of gratitude through the delightful adventures of Little Critter. In this charming story, Little Critter finds himself constantly comparing what he has to what his friends possess and feels disappointed. Gator sports brand-new, flashy sneakers, while Little Critter is left with his plain blue ones. Tiger’s dad owns a boat, something Little Critter's dad doesn't have. Even indulging at the ice cream shop doesn't bring joy, as Little Critter’s chocolate ice cream cone pales in comparison to the enormous sundae he desires.
A turning point comes as Grandma takes Little Critter on a memorable trip to the farm. With her gentle guidance, she helps him see the blessings he has been overlooking. Through her wisdom, Little Critter learns the beauty of being thankful, realising that a grateful heart can transform any situation into a joyful one.
Being Thankful not only captures the relatable struggles of envy and discontent but also offers a profound lesson on finding happiness in everyday blessings. Inspired by Psalm 107:1, this book aims to instill a spirit of gratitude in young minds, helping children ages 3 to 6 to:

Since 1975, Mercer Mayer has been enchanting audiences with the adventures of Little Critter, a character that humorously navigates the complexities of growing up. By partnering with Tommy Nelson, these stories now also embrace faith-based themes, addressing social and emotional issues with a Christian perspective.

About the Author
Mercer Mayer is the writer and illustrator for Little Monster® and Little Critter® books. He began writing and illustrating children's books in 1966 and since that time, he has published over 300 titles. Mayer currently lives in New England with his wife Gina, who co-wrote many of the popular Little Critter® books. He has four children and two grandchildren.
